Webof the pipelined ternary processor, and provides the required processing cycles for performing the input ternary assembly codes. With the synthesizable RTL design corresponding to the high-level architecture description, the proposed gate-level analyzer can estimate the critical delay as well as the power consumption of ternary processor. Web22 Jul 2024 · Ternary logic is not going to be used in general purpose computing. You may find small accelerator sections on microcontrollers with ternary logic already, and it is thought it might make some of the so-called "deep learning" processors a bit more compact if ternary logic were supported in their convolution matrix operations.
